as my experience,
1. I downloaded the English lang.js file from the server's .../projeqtor/tool/i18n/nls/en folder
2.then convert to excel format (lang.xls file downloaded from https://www.projeqtor.org/files/lang.xls);
3. Take the English content and convert it to MS Word so that it can be automatically translated into the original Vietnamese file; Then copy it into the excel file lang.xls, with the column titled vn; you would correct the translation as you like.
Use the macro in the lang.xls file to create a new js file - stored in the vn folder
4. Copy back the lang.js file to the server's /projeqtor/tool/i18n/nls/vn folder

How can I download the texts to be translated in the form of an Excel file (or tab delimeted text file) with the 'code' column and 'version' column, along with 'Default, EN, FR, DE, TR' languages? How can I update it to see my translations on the actual screen in my system in between?
In the lang.projeqtor.org application, just click on the download icon.
This will have two effects :
- You will get a zip file with all the lang.js files, that you can import to your own server on import into Excel.
- The trasnlated files are installed on the lang.projeqtor.org instance, where you can directly test your translations
